WebbThe constant value (often written k) relating amounts that rise or fall uniformly together. It is the ratio of the amounts y and x: k = y/x Put another way: y = kx Example: you are paid $20 an hour The constant of proportionality is 20 because: Pay = 20 × Hours worked Directly Proportional WebbIdentify the constant of proportionality (unit rate) in tables, graphs, equations, diagrams, and verbal descriptions of proportional relationships. WebbSo we either have c = x / y or c = x · y where c is then the constant of proportionality between x and y. With direct proportionality we have c = x / y which we can also express that as c / 1 = x / y and solve for c using the calculator above. If y = 5 for x = 20, then we have c / 1 = 20 / 5 hence c = 4.
